Job Summary
Participate in an approximately 18-month rotational development program designed to provide broad, hands-on experience in multiple aspects of heavy and highway construction. Rotations may include Field Operations, Project Superintendent, Project Management, and Estimating, with individual assignments generally lasting three to six months based on business needs, individual development, and interest. Work alongside experienced construction professionals to develop an understanding of construction means and methods, field operations, project planning and execution, estimating, cost management, scheduling, safety, quality, and project administration.
The rotational program is designed to prepare the employee for potential placement in a regular full-time position upon completion of the program, based on individual performance, interests and strengths, available opportunities, and Company needs. If you are placed in a regular full-time position following rotational program, your job will be subject to the job description of that position. During the rotational program, your employment is at-will and your performance will be evaluated regularly through each phase of the program, similar to a probation or introductory period of employment.
This salaried, nonexempt position will work with direct supervision.
